Power Supply

(USB Cable only. 3-pin wall socket not supplied). Connect the USB Type-C charging cable to the S2. Connect the other end of the USB 2.0 cable to a PC or mobile phone charging plug with the same USB type.

Key-lock function:

The Key-lock function prevents unintentional operation of your radio.

  1. Set the Lock switch located on the top of your radio to the “Lock” position. If the radio is switched on, “Key locked” will appear on the display. The ON/OFF and all other buttons will be disabled.
  2. To release the Lock switch, move the lock switch to the “Unlock” position.

Operating your radio - DAB:

  1. Make sure the Aerial is extended or Earphones are attached for better signal/reception.
  2. Press and hold the ON/OFF button until the radio switches on. The display shows “Azatom Digital radio”.
  3. Press MODE button to select DAB mode.
  4. If this is the first time the radio is used, a quick scan of DAB channels will be performed. If the radio has been used before, the last used station will be selected.
  5. Press and hold “SCAN” for autoscan. During the scanning process, the lower line of the display shows a bar-graph indicating progress of the scan.
  6. When the scanning is completed, the first station (in numeric-alpha order 0-9, A-Z) will be selected. Your radio will automatically set to the current time.
  7. If the station list is still empty after the scan, your radio will display “Service not available”.
  8. If no signals are found, it may be necessary to relocate your radio to a position giving better reception.

Selecting a station - DAB:

  1. The top line of the display shows the name of the station currently selected.
  2. Press the CH+ / CH- buttons to select from the list of available stations shown on the lower line of the display. Press ENTER to play that station.

Note: If after selecting a station the display shows “service not available”, it may be necessary to relocate your radio to a position giving better reception.

Secondary services - DAB

Certain radio stations have one or more secondary services associated with them. If a radio station has a secondary service associated with it, the display will show “→→” next to the station name on the station list. The secondary service will then appear immediately after the primary services as you press the CH+/ CH- buttons and select the highlighted secondary service.

Finding new radio stations - DAB:

To update and add new available stations, follow these steps:

Press and hold SCAN button for auto scan to start. The display will show “Scanning...” and your radio will perform a scan of DAB channels. As radio stations are found, the station counter on the right-hand side of the display will increase, and the radio stations will be added to the list stored in the radio.

Sleep function:

Your radio can be set to turn off after a preset time between 15 and 90 minutes. Ensure the radio is on.

  1. Press and hold MENU button until to enter the menu.
  2. Press CH+ or CH- until “Settings” is on the display. Press ENTER.
  3. Press CH+ or CH- until “Set Sleep time” is highlighted on the display. Press ENTER.
  4. Press CH+ or CH- to set sleep time of 15, 30, 45, 60, and 90 minutes or Off, which cancels the sleep function.
  5. Press ENTER to confirm the setting. The sleep timer indicator “S” will show on the display.

Full Scan function - DAB:

  1. Press and hold the MENU button until “Station Info” appears.
  2. Press CH+ / CH- until “Full Scan” is highlighted and select that option.
  3. Press ENTER to confirm. Scanning will start. All DAB & DAB+ available will be saved in memory.

Manual Tuning - DAB:

Manual tuning allows you to tune your radio to a particular DAB Frequency Band III. Any new stations found will be added to the station list.

  1. When in DAB mode, press MENU until the display shows “Station Info”.
  2. Press CH+ / CH- buttons until the display shows “Manual Tune”. Press ENTER to select this function.
  3. Press CH+ / CH- to highlight the desired Frequency/channel. Press ENTER.

The display will show a graph which will indicate the signal strength, and the upper line will show the name of the DAB multiplex (group of radio stations). Any stations found will be added to the stored list in the radio.

  1. Press and hold MENU button to return to main menu.
  2. Press and hold MENU button a second time to return to DAB radio.

Operating your radio - Manual tuning - FM:

  1. Make sure the Aerial is extended or the Earphones are attached for better signal/reception.
  2. Press and hold the ON/OFF button until the radio switches on.
  3. Short press MODE button to enter “FM” mode.
  4. Short press CH+/CH- buttons to tune to a station. With each press, the frequency will change up or down by 50 kHz.

Preset Stations:

You can store your preferred DAB and FM stations to memory. There are 40 for DAB and 40 for FM.

  1. Select the mode: DAB or FM.
  2. Tune to the station you want to preset and press ENTER to play it.
  3. Press and hold PS button until “Preset Store” shows on display.
  4. Press the CH+ or CH- to choose which preset number you want to save the station in.
  5. Press ENTER to confirm. The display shows “Preset 01 Stored”. Repeat this procedure as needed for the different preset numbers.

Note: The station must be playing before you can save the station in Preset stored.

Recalling a preset:

  1. Select the mode: DAB or FM.
  2. Press and hold the PR button until “Preset Recall” shows on the display.
  3. Press the CH+ or CH- to choose which preset station you want to play.
  4. Press ENTER to select and play that station.

Note: If you have not previously stored a preset station and the preset button is pressed, “Empty preset” will be displayed.

Time/Date Setting:

When there is no DAB signal, you will need to set the TIME and DATE manually.

  1. Press and hold MENU button until it enters the settings menu.
  2. Press CH+ or CH- until “Settings” displays, press ENTER.
  3. Press CH+ or CH- until “Set Time/Date” displays, press ENTER.
  4. Use the CH+ or CH- to set the correct Time/Date and press ENTER to confirm.

Earphones:

Whilst the earphones are connected to your radio, they act as an aerial when the metal antenna is down. The cable should be extended as much as possible to increase reception strength.

  1. Plug the earphones into the Earphone socket on the top of your radio.
  2. Check that the volume level is not too loud before placing the ear-pieces into your ears.

IMPORTANT: Do not switch on the radio with the earphones connected and inserted in your ear. Excessive sound pressure from earphones can cause hearing loss.

Backlight/Display brightness:

It is possible to set the backlight to dim after an elapsed time. This can save battery life.

  1. To set the backlight dimmer, press and hold MENU to enter the menu. Press CH+ / CH- until “Settings” shows on the display. Press ENTER.
  2. Press CH+ or CH- until “Backlight” shows on the display. Press ENTER.

TIME OUT: Set dimmer time from 10 to 180 seconds or ON. When set to “ON”, the display will not dim after an elapsed time, so the battery playing time will be less.

DIM LEVEL: Set the dimmer brightness “High, Medium or Low” when TIME OUT has been activated.

ON LEVEL: Set the brightness “HIGH, MEDIUM or LOW”.

Factory reset:

There are two ways:

A. Use the factory reset tool. Push it into the earphone socket until you feel the button press.

B. Reset via the software menu.

  1. Press and hold MENU button to enter the menu.
  2. Press CH+ or CH- buttons until the display shows “Settings”. Press ENTER.
  3. Press CH+ or CH- until the display shows “Factory Reset”. Press ENTER.
  4. Press the CH+ or CH- until “YES” is highlighted on the display. Press ENTER. A reset of your radio will be performed. All presets and station lists will be erased.
  5. After a system reset, a scan of the DAB band will be performed.
